On the basis of indices and sub-indices, an overall index is calculated. In general, national statistical agencies are responsible for the calculation of CPI. Definition of RPI. RPI, an acronym for Retail Price Index. It is a statistics that calculates the variations in the cost of a market basket of retail goods and services. Basis of Comparison between CPI vs RPI: Consumer Price Index (CPI) Retail Price Index (RPI) Definition: CPI measures the weighted average prices of the basket of goods and services consumed by households. RPI is a measure of consumer inflation which considers the changes in the retail prices of a basket of goods and services. Components
